Her Royal Highness offers fresh insight into the private life of this famous royal couple, from the early years together to the tragedy of the prince's premature death, and of the house that can be seen as a monument to their marriage. 200 photographs, 100 in color.

Whether you're interested in Queen Victoria or in Osborne House, this is a fascinating glimpse into the lives of Queen Victoria, Prince Albert and their 9 children. The photographs and paintings reproduced add to the uniqueness of this book. As someone who lived on the Isle of Wight and has visited Osborne on more than 1 occasion, and also someone who has researched Queen Victoria and her family (as a writer), even I found I learned a lot from the book. The text is informative, funny (in places) and (because Sarah was allowed privileged access to the Royal Archive) also very personal. Some of the information will never be reproduced. Victoria always thought of Osborne as home, somewhere she and the family could really relax and be as normal as you can get when you are Queen! The people of the island always did, and probably always will, hold a special affection for Victoria and her family. All in all, it is a cracking read and I guarantee it will encourage you to find out more about this fascinating monarch and her offspring - many of whom became royalty around the world.
